玉郎伞查尔酮对大鼠心肌缺血再灌注损伤后炎性反应的影响  被引量:3

Effects of 17-methoxyl-7-hydroxyl-benzofuran chalcone on inflammatory responses in myocardial ischemia reperfusion injury in rats

摘  要:目的观察玉郎伞查尔酮(YLSC)对大鼠心肌缺血再灌注后炎性反应的影响。方法将60只12周龄的SPF级SD大鼠按随机数字表法分为假手术组(等体积生理盐水),模型组(等体积生理盐水),阳性组(葛根素注射液12.00mg/kg),YLSC低剂量组(2.50mg/kg)、中剂量组(YLSC5.00mg/kg)和高剂量组(YLSC10.00mg/kg),每组10只,雌雄各半。缺血1h再灌注3h复制大鼠缺血再灌注模型。假手术组只穿线不结扎。采用酶联免疫吸附法检测大鼠血清MB型肌酸激酶(CK-MB)、肌钙蛋白(cTnI)、白细胞介素-6(IL-6)、白细胞介素-1β(IL-1β)、肿瘤坏死因子-α(TNF-α)的含量。伊文思蓝和2,3,5-三苯基氯化四氮唑双重染色确定心肌梗死面积。Westernblot法检测心肌高迁移率族蛋白1(HMGB1)、Toll样受体4(TLR4)和核转录因子κB(NF-κB)。结果与模型组比较,YLSC能减少心肌酶CK-MB、cTnI的漏出(P<0.05或P<0.01),缩小心肌梗死面积(P<0.05或P<0.01),降低血清炎症因子IL-6、IL-1β、TNF-α的释放(P<0.05或P<0.01),并抑制心肌HMGB1、TLR4、NF-κB的蛋白表达(P<0.05或P<0.01)。结论YLSC能减少大鼠缺血再灌注损伤,其心肌保护作用可能与减轻炎性反应,抑制心肌HMGB1、TLR4、NF-κB的蛋白表达有关。Objective To observe the effects of 17-methoxyl-7-hydroxyl-benzofuran chalcone (YLSC) on inflammatory responses in myocardial ischemia reperfusion injury in rats.Methods Sixty 12-month-old SPF Sprague-Dawley (SD) rats were randomly divided into sham group (equal volume of normal saline),model group (equal volume of normal saline),positive control group (Puerarin Injection,12.00 mg/kg) and YLSC low,medium and high-dose groups (2.50,5.00,10.00 mg/kg) via random number table method.The anterior descending coronary artery was ligated for 1 h then reperfused for 3 h to establish the ischemia reperfusion (I/R) model.Rats in sham group were applied stitches under the coronary artery without ligation.Levels of serum troponin I (cTnI),creatine kinase-MB (CK-MB),interleukin-6 (IL-6),interleukin-1β(IL-1β) and tumor necrosis factor-α(TNF-α) were examined by enzyme-linked immunosorbent assay.The infarct sizes were measured by evans blue and 2,3,5-triphenyltetrazolium chloride staining.Protein levels of high mobility group box-1(HMGB1),toll-like receptors 4 (TLR4) and nuclear factor-kappa B (NF-κB) in myocardiums were evaluated using Western blot.Results Compared with model group,YLSC reduced the leakage of myocardial enzyme CK-MB and cTnI (P < 0.05 or P < 0.01),decreased myocardial infarction size (P < 0.05 or P < 0.01),lower the release of serum inflammatory cytokines such as IL-6,IL-1β and TNF-α(P < 0.05 or P < 0.01),and inhibited the protein expression of myocardial HMGB1,TLR4,NF-κB (P < 0.05 or P < 0.01).Conclusion YLSC can reduce ischemia-reperfusion injury in rats,the myocardial protective effect may be related to reducing of inflammatory reaction,inhibiting the expression of myocardial related protein such as HMGB1,TLR4 and NF-κB.
